Today, January 16, during his visit to Kyiv, Czech President Petr Pavel honored the memory of the fallen Ukrainian defenders. The Czech president visited the Wall of Remembrance together with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y.
This was reported by Volodymyr Zelenskyy.
“We will always be grateful to each and every one of them for everything they have done to preserve Ukraine, for standing up for our state and fighting the enemy. Bright memory to the soldiers. Eternal gratitude,” the statement said.
The Czech president arrived in Kyiv on January 16. He was met by Ukrainian Foreign Minister Andriy Sybiga.
“We look forward to meaningful talks with President Volodymyr Zelenskyy to deepen our strategic partnership, defense cooperation, and peace efforts. We are grateful to the Czech Republic and its people for their support of Ukraine,” the minister said.
Petr Pavel is visiting Ukraine for the third time. This time, he began his visit in Lviv, where he met with Lviv Regional State Administration Head Maksym Kozytskyi.
